Function aligns value from one set to another. The function will have a removable discontinuity at x = -3.
What is Function?
A function assigns the value of each element of one set to the other specific element of another set.
As the function is given to us,
[tex]F(x) = \dfrac{(x^2+12x+27)}{(x^2+4x+3)}[/tex]
Now, factorizing the numerator and the denominator,
[tex]F(x)=\dfrac{(x+3)(x+9)}{(x+3)(x+1)}[/tex]
Now, in order to find the point at which the function will be discontinued, we will equate the denominator with 0.
[tex](x+3)(x+1)=0\\\\\\(x+3)=0\\x =-3\\\\\\(x+1)=0\\x=-1[/tex]
Now, As (x+3) is the factor of the numerator and the denominator, therefore, you will have a removable discontinuity, which appears as a hole in the graph.
Hence, the function will have a removable discontinuity at x = -3.
